Black Drum Fun - Hanging around the docks near Cayo Costa and under the boat house at Mondongo, the black drum are in the 4 to 5 pound range. Number one owner hook on a 16 30 lb mono leader, half oz egg slip sinker above a small shrimp will do the trick. Also, at bl more...

Awesome Dolphin Fishing in Fort Lauderdale Continues -
Great dolphin fishing this week, same as last. The dolphin are still right in on the reef and feeding voraciously. Lots of peanut sized ones and few bull dolphin sized fish are chewing just about anything you can throw out at them. Dolphin aren' more...

The Bite in November -
Fishing has been good offshore! We have had to pick our days with the sea conditions. Around the edge we are catching Sailfish, Kings, and Dolphin. Sailfish are starting to show up in numbers. We have been getting a couple hook ups every trip. K more...
